Importance of Effective Bookkeeping

Firstly, let’s emphasize why solid bookkeeping practices are essential. Efficient bookkeeping not only ensures compliance with tax regulations but also offers a clear picture of your agency’s financial health. It helps in monitoring cash flow, making informed business decisions, and demonstrating financial stability to potential investors or stakeholders.

Setting Up a Chart of Accounts

A well-organized chart of accounts is the backbone of your financial records. It categorizes your agency’s transactions into different accounts, allowing you to track income, expenses, assets, and liabilities systematically.

For instance, create separate accounts for various revenue streams—consulting fees, project-based income, or commission earned—to better understand the sources driving your agency’s revenue.

Choosing the Right Accounting Software

Investing in reliable accounting software tailored for agency-style businesses can streamline your bookkeeping process. Options like QuickBooks or Xero offer features designed to manage client billing, track project expenses, and generate detailed financial reports.

Choosing the software that aligns with your business needs can significantly enhance efficiency and accuracy in bookkeeping.

Tracking Income and Expenses

In an agency-style business, income might arrive from various sources—client projects, commissions, retainer fees, or royalties. It’s vital to diligently record each income stream to assess profitability accurately.

Likewise, meticulously track expenses related to client acquisition, project execution, employee salaries, office rent, marketing, and other overhead costs. Organizing expenses ensures better cost management and tax deductions.

Managing Client Invoices and Payments

Timely and accurate invoicing is crucial for maintaining healthy cash flow. Implementing a systematic invoicing process—issuing invoices promptly, clearly outlining services rendered, and payment terms, and following up on overdue payments—ensures consistent revenue flow.

Consider using invoicing software that integrates with your accounting system to streamline the invoicing and payment collection process.

Reconciling Bank Statements

Regularly reconciling your bank statements with your accounting records helps identify discrepancies and ensures accuracy. This practice allows you to catch errors, detect fraudulent activities, and maintain a clear understanding of your agency’s financial status.

Seeking Professional Assistance

For complex financial tasks or when navigating tax regulations, seeking professional assistance from accountants or financial advisors specializing in agency-style businesses can be invaluable. They can offer expert guidance, help with tax planning, and ensure compliance with legal requirements.
